Explanation / Answer

1. Molarity = moles of solute / Volume of solution in L

Moles = Mass/Molar mass

Mass = 20.0g

Molar mass = 111.1g/mol

Moles = 20.0g/111.1g/mol = 0.18moles

Volume = 1200mL = 1.2L

Molarity = 0.18moles/1.2L = 0.15M
